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

Described herein are industrial application systems for treating (e.g., forming protective coatings on) produce, agricultural products, or other items. An exemplary application system can include a bed comprising a plurality of rollers, one or more sprayers over a first portion of the bed, one or more blowers over a second portion of the bed, a mixing system configured to prepare a mixture comprising a coating agent in a solvent, and a liquid delivery system connected inline between the mixing system and the one or more sprayers. Items placed on the bed can have the mixture applied to their surfaces via the one or more sprayers, after which the one or more blowers can at least partially remove the solvent from the surfaces of the perishable items, thereby causing the protective coatings to be formed over the perishable items.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

1 . An application system for forming protective coatings over perishable items, comprising: a bed comprising a plurality of rollers, wherein each of the rollers is configured to rotate at a predetermined rotational rate, thereby causing the perishable items on the bed to rotate; one or more sprayers over a first portion of the bed; one or more blowers over a second portion of the bed; a mixing system configured to prepare a mixture comprising a coating agent in a solvent; and a liquid delivery system connected inline between the mixing system and the one or more sprayers. 2 . The application system of claim 1 , wherein the application system is configured such that the mixture is applied to the perishable items via the one or more sprayers while the perishable items are rotating and are over the first portion of the bed. 3 . The application system of claim 2 , wherein the application system is further configured such that after the mixture is applied to the perishable items, the perishable items move to over the second portion of the bed, and while the perishable items are rotating and are over the second portion of the bed the one or more blowers at least partially remove the solvent from the surfaces of the perishable items, thereby causing the protective coatings to be formed over the perishable items. 4 . The application system of claim 1 , wherein the mixing system causes at least 95% of coating agent particles in the mixture to have a size in a range of 50 nm to 2000 nm after the mixture has been mixed in the mixing system for between 5 and 30 minutes. 5 . The application system of claim 4 , wherein the size is in a range of 75 nm to 1000 nm. 6 . The application system of claim 1 , wherein the rollers comprise brushbed rollers. 7 . The application system of claim 1 , wherein one or more rollers in the first portion of the bed comprise a first type of brushbed roller and one or more rollers in the second portion of the bed comprise a second type of brushbed roller different from the first type of brushbed roller. 8 . The application system of claim 1 , wherein the blowers are configured to heat the air or gas dispensed therefrom. 9 . The application system of claim 1 , wherein the second portion of the bed is less than 12 feet long. 10 . The application system of claim 9 , wherein the entire length of the bed is less than 20 feet. 11 . The application system of claim 9 , wherein the one or more blowers are configured to substantially dry each of the perishable items in a time of 300 seconds or less. 12 . The application system of claim 1 , wherein the one or more blowers are configured to substantially dry each of the perishable items in a time of 300 seconds or less. 13 . A method of forming a protective coating over a plurality of perishable items, comprising: (i) placing the perishable items on a bed of an application system, wherein the application system comprises: the bed, wherein the bed comprises a plurality of rollers, wherein each of the rollers is configured to rotate at a predetermined rotational rate, thereby causing the perishable items on the bed to rotate; one or more sprayers over a first portion of the bed; one or more blowers over a second portion of the bed; a mixing system configured to prepare a mixture comprising a coating agent in a solvent; and a liquid delivery system connected inline between the mixing system and the one or more sprayers; (ii) while the perishable items are rotating and are over the first portion of the bed, causing the mixture to be applied to the perishable items via the one or more sprayers; and (iii) while the perishable items are rotating and are over the second portion of the bed, allowing the one or more blowers to at least partially remove the solvent from the surfaces of the perishable items, thereby causing the protective coating to be formed over the perishable items. 14 . The method of claim 13 , wherein the mixing system causes at least 95% of coating agent particles in the mixture to have a size in a range of 50 nm to 2000 nm after the mixture has been mixed in the mixing system for between 5 and 30 minutes. 15 . The method of claim 14 , wherein the size is in a range of 75 nm to 1000 nm. 16 . The method of claim 13 , wherein the rollers comprise brushbed rollers. 17 . The method of claim 13 , wherein one or more rollers in the first portion of the bed comprise a first type of brushbed roller and one or more rollers in the second portion of the bed comprise a second type of brushbed roller different from the first type of brushbed roller. 18 . The method of claim 13 , wherein the blowers heat the air or gas dispensed therefrom while the perishable items are over the second portion of the bed. 19 . The method of claim 13 , wherein the second portion of the bed is less than 12 feet long. 20 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the entire length of the bed is less than 20 feet. 21 . (canceled)
